Subject: Key rotation — Largediff service

For future maintainers: the Largediff viewer's backend key rotated today. Old key revoked, effective immediately. The viewer streams chunked diffs for files over 50 MB via the Strathmere render service; without a valid key it silently falls back to plain text, which users report as "diff broken." Update the deploy config, restart the render pods, confirm chunk streaming in the health dashboard. Rotation cadence is quarterly going forward. New key for the Strathmere service follows.

app token of yajeg-kawef = kto11_7En3XSX8xQw

// Client setup for the Pallox pick-list optimizer (release channel: stable).
// This client calls the internal Binwright routing service to fetch
// optimized pick sequences per warehouse zone. Timeouts are set to 5s
// with two retries; do not raise them without checking Binwright load.
// Release manager note: the service authenticates with the internal
// API key that follows.

API key for fahip-kahip: zpat23_XiJGUHz5xfaAtaIqUkus0rh

## Runbook: Query planner regression (Lattern DB)

If p95 latency spikes after a Lattern upgrade, suspect the planner's new join-reordering pass. Confirm by diffing plans for the top five slow queries against last known good. Reviewers should verify any mitigation pins the planner version rather than disabling statistics. To roll back planner behavior, apply the settings below.

config for kagup-hahig:
druwyn:
  pin: 2801
  metrics_host: metrics.druwyn.zemvarlabs.internal
  tenant: sorius
  seal: seal_798a43d7

**Q: How does the Lattermill timetable solver handle constraint data from schools?**

A: All uploaded constraint files are parsed in a sandboxed worker with no outbound network access, and raw uploads are purged within 24 hours of a successful solve. Solver output contains only anonymized slot identifiers; student names never enter the optimization layer. Access to solver logs requires membership in the restricted review group. For the complete data-flow diagram and retention policy, consult the internal security page linked below.

dashboard of bafof-hafog = https://confluence.lumiclabs.internal/display/browse/display/6a09a20a